Saints Row 2 brings true freedom to open-world gaming. Players can play as who they want, how they want, and with whomever they want in this sequel to the much acclaimed and tremendously successful Saints Row. Set years after the original, the player finds himself in a Stilwater both familiar and strange and challenged with bringing the Saints back as the rightful kings of Stilwater and bringing vengeance to those who wronged him.

It was obvious this game was going to be compared to GTA IV, but in terms of fun, SR2 trumps the mighty GTA.

The story is rather forgettable, but here goes: you return as your previous character from the original Saints Row, and break out of jail to return to Stilwater. But seriously, what's the point in doing the story when you can smack people miles with a giant foam hand with the middle finger sticking up?

Talking of sticking up middle fingers, you will probably be doing a lot of that in SR2. You now get to choose your own taunts, the way you respect people, the way you walk, the way you talk, etc, etc, etc. My personal favorite taunt is The Dumper, where you pretend to take a poo on someone! But that's not all in customization values: you can customize yourself thoroughly, your cars thoroughly, and now you can even customize your crib and gang.

Graphics-wise it's a bit bargain bin compared to GTA, with some tear here and there and generally rather bland visuals. Expect a few bugs as well - there are plenty of them in SR2.

There are some interesting new weapons as well, including the the aforementioned 'Pimp Slap' (giant foam hand) and chainsaws, flamethrowers, Annihaltors (rocket launchers) and a bunch of other ways of torture.

The gameplay is the best fun ever, offline or in co-op with a mate. Driving has been criticised for being overly simplistic but I don't really care to be honest. It won't stop me from drive-bying a hooker with a friend over Xbox Live!

To conclude, Welcome back to Stilwater.

I paid full price for this on pre-order as I was a huge fan of the first game, so a little annoyed at how low it is now :-( Been playing for some time now, and wow! It has all the great points of the first game, and seems to have ironed out a lot of the bad points like having to replay a whole mission with no checkpoints. Other improvements are autosave and much improved graphics and character customization. If you have never played the first, it's basically GTA with attitude! You return as your 'hero' from the first game, busting out of jail to find a world that has changed massively whilst you have been away. One small problem, it has frozen on me a couple of times, but not sure if that's my 360 or the game. 5 stars at this price!

If you, like me, felt let down by the over hyped, drastically under-delivering GTA IV then I seriously recommend this to you as a similar themed but much more fun game to get your teeth into.

Right from the start I knew that I was in for a good ride, the first mission is fun and cool, without being too hard or tricky. You also get a good feel for the game during the first mission, unlike GTA IV where your just driving a car around in the dark (what fun!)

From here on in you shouldn't be getting bored or stuck for things to do. Theres alot to buy with the money you earn and a whole world of side missions and escapades to be getting stuck into. One of the coolest things about this game is the ability to buy and customize cribs; can even choose what type of bed and TV you will have in your pad!

Cut scenes are entertaining to say the least. These are actually worth watching due to the fast paced action/gunfight scenes that frequent them. They're not just some boring string of conversations between 2 Russian mobsters *no names mentioned*.

Gangs are interesting and unique looking, and fun to mow down or blow up! The graphics are neat and a big step up from the first outing, as is the car dynamics and character movement. Flashy, eye catching HUDs and on screen commands. I could go on about how sweet this game is.

If you even semi liked Saints Row...then it would be a sin not to play this.A+
